The Danger of Sandflies for Dogs

Sandflies are a type of small mosquito found in warmer countries. They are especially active during sunrise and sunset. Sandflies can transmit the Leishmania parasite, causing the unpleasant chronic disease Leishmaniasis.

After infection, it often takes years before the dog becomes ill. Dogs with Leishmaniasis lose weight, may develop skin issues, and can even die from the disease. The condition is treatable but not curable. Therefore, it is wise to prevent your dog from being infected with the Leishmania parasite!

Preventing Sandflies

If you are going on holiday to a country where sandflies are present, it is important to protect your dog as best as possible from sandflies.

The Scalibor Protector Band is a registered and approved product for use against sandflies. The band should be applied one week before traveling to an area where sandflies are present and will then be effective for five to six months. The Seresto Collar also reduces the risk of Leishmania transmission for eight months. If you prefer a spot-on product, you can choose, for example, Advantix (effective for two to three weeks) or Vectra 3D (effective for four weeks).
